Finding Aids to Official Records of the Smithsonian Institution Archives

Accession 23-033

National Air and Space Museum. Albert Einstein Spacearium

Development and Operation Records, 1973-1976

Repository:Smithsonian Institution Archives, Washington, D.C. Contact us at osiaref@si.edu.
Creator:National Air and Space Museum. Albert Einstein Spacearium
Title:Development and Operation Records
Dates:1973-1976
Quantity:0.40 cu. ft. (1 half document box) (1 oversize folder)
Collection:Accession 23-033
Language of Materials:English
Summary:

This accession consists of records documenting the design, installation, and operation of various custom components of and equipment associated with the Albert Einstein Spacearium, the National Air and Space Museum's planetarium. Particularly well documented are the design and installation of the turntable on which the projector would be mounted and the testing and modification of the elevator that would be used for the transport of heavy equipment. Materials include correspondence, construction drawings, specifications, schematics, manuals, reports, and related materials.
